The RGB color code for color number #733741 is RGB(115, 55, 65). In the RGB color model, #733741 has a red value of 115, a green value of 55, and a blue value of 65.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 0.0% cyan, 52.2% magenta, 43.5% yellow, and 54.9%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 350° (degrees), 35.3 % saturation, and 33.3 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#733741 has a hue of 350° (degrees), 52.2 % saturation and 45.1 % brightness/value.
Color 733741 is cool or warm?
Color 733741 is a warm color.
What is the LRV of 733741?
Color code 733741 has an LRV of nearly 7.
By LRV value, it is a dark color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).
